What Is Frequency Specific Microcurrent Therapy (FSM)?

Frequency Specific Microcurrent Therapy (FSM) is the practice of introducing a mild electrical current (one-millionth of an amp) into an area of damaged soft tissue. The introduced current enhances the healing process in that tissue. Frequency Specific Microcurrent Therapy takes advantage of the body’s ability to respond to specific frequencies to heal new or chronic injuries.

What Is a Microcurrent?

A microcurrent is a tiny electric current that is only a few millionths of an ampere. An ampere is the measurement of the movement of electrons past a certain point. Your body produces this type of current within each cell on its own. You can tell the machine is running by watching the conductance meter on the device, but the current is so small that it cannot be felt as it flows through the sensory nerves.

How does Frequency Specific Microcurrent Therapy (FSM) work?
When treated with Frequency Specific Microcurrent Therapy, your healthcare provider uses an FSM device to deliver a mild electrical current to specific body parts. The electrical current used in this treatment is exceptionally mild — one-millionth of an ampere. Such a small amount of electrical current is safe. Interestingly, the human body actually produces its own current within each of your cells.

Depending on the tissue involved, specific frequencies will be selected to encourage natural healing of the body and to reduce your pain. There are frequencies for nearly every type of tissue in your body.

One of the ways FSM works is by potentially increasing the production of a substance called ATP that’s inside injured tissues. ATP is the primary source of energy for all cellular reactions in your body. Because treatment with FSM can increase the amount of ATP created in your damaged cells by as much as 500%, this treatment may help your recovery. Depending on the condition, treatment with FSM can “loosen” or soften the muscles, which can help relieve pain or stiffness.

Are There Any Risks or Dangers to the Patient?

There are no risks to the patient that we know of, as long as the practitioner follows the proper contraindications and precautions associated with both Frequency Specific Microcurrent and the use of microcurrent. There are frequencies used to remove scar tissue that should not be used within six weeks of a new injury. When muscles are successfully treated, the range of motion can increase so much that joints and nerves may become temporarily painful until the range of motion returns to normal. Also, after muscles are treated, a detoxification reaction may occur 90 minutes after treatment. This can be lessened by drinking water and taking an antioxidant combination supplement.

The following populations are advised against using Frequency Specific Microcurrent:
People with pacemakers.
People with implanted pumps.
Pregnant women.
People who have uncontrolled seizures.

Finally, it is NOT recommended that the frequencies be used to treat cancer. The condition is too severe and complicated to address with this technique. Specific frequencies also shouldn’t be used in cases of acute infection, new scar tissue (within six weeks), and acute fractures. Talk about any of these concerns with your healthcare provider before treatment.

What is the Difference Between the Microcurrent and a Laser?

Microcurrent provides electrons and has been shown to increase ATP production in cells. Lasers provide photons and use one frequency at a time from an oscillating set of frequencies, unlike microcurrent, which uses dual frequencies. Lasers provide their benefits through methods different from Frequency Specific resonance and ATP enhancement.

What Is the History of Frequency Specific Microcurrent?

Working with the frequencies of the body began in the 1920s when scientists measured the frequency of each body part. For example, they discovered that when they placed a very low voltage (124 millihertz) on a bone (59 millihertz) that it stimulated the natural tendency of the healing cells in the bone and it mended much more quickly. Scientists continually find new combinations of frequencies to speed the healing of the body.

There are a number of devices that can deliver a micro amperage current; however, all of the research and papers published on Frequency Specific Microcurrent (FSM) have been done using a device manufactured by Precision Microcurrent, Inc.
